Winter Weather Advisory and Wind Chill Warning In Effect

The National Weather Service has issued a winter weather advisory in effect from noon today to noon Saturday, December 17.

A wind chill warning is also in effect from noon Saturday to 11 a.m. on Sunday, December 18.

According to the National Weather Service, snow is expected to develop this afternoon, preceded by some patchy freezing drizzle. Snow accumulations of two to four inches are possible, and north to northwest winds increasing to 15 to 30 mph could create areas of blowing snow and reduced visibility, especially in open areas. Travel may be hazardous. 

Wind chill values are also expected to fall to 20 below by midday Saturday and 30 below on Saturday night and early morning Sunday. The National Weather Service is urgning residents to use caution and be prepared, as dangerously low wind chill values will cause frost bite to exposed skin in a short period of time. 

A winter weather advisory means that periods of snow, sleet or freezing rain will cause travel difficulties. Be prepared for slippery roads and limited visibilites and use caution while driving. A wind chill warning means the combination of very cold air and strong winds will create dangerously low chill values. This will result in frosbite and lead to hypothermia or death if precuations are not taken. ​
